Your badge (name plate in Fordspeak) should be PN E0TZ 16720-AA, as seen on the page at Documentation/Exterior/Name Plates.

I've been looking for Trailer Special emblems for almost ten years now. I've never seen them for sale online in that time, but did find a rough pair in the local junkyard years ago. I put them on my F150, and should have kept them when I sold that truck because there very hard to find. They were only used from 1980-1981, hence their rarity.

I would suggest maybe looking into having somebody make a small vinyl decal based off of your existing emblem and then putting it into a used Lariat frame that is missing the Lariat script. You can find the "broken" Lariat emblem frames on Ebay pretty easily because they were used for so long.

Thanks again for the info Shaun. Do you know if Ford kept records on how many trailer specials were made between both years and were they available for f150, f250 and f350 models as well?

I know that whenever you buy the second tier Marti Report for these trucks, it will break down how many trucks were ordered with certain colors and options, so I'm sure they did. Kevin Marti bought most of Ford's old records and now offers his Marti Reports that tell you all about your vehicle. Only downside is that it will only give you info for a specific year. And I'm not sure if the Trailer Special packages are listed on the Marti Reports.

I do know that the Trailer Special package was available on Bronco, F150, F250, and F350. There were two different packages, one was for light duty towing and the other was for heavy duty towing.

The Camper Special package was for F250 and F350 trucks only, so those emblems are probably harder to find.

According to rearcounter.com, NOS Parts LTD. has a single Trailer Special emblem in stock. You might want to give them a call and verify that info. I don't really know their pricing, but it might not be cheap.
